Breakfast Taco of the God's...

eggs, queso, steak, spanish rice, tortilla strips, and whatever salsa you choose. I like the salsa Olivia and the salsa Mexicana personally. I think it comes on a whole wheat tortilla but I dont remember exactly.

Its named after some cop named Kevin who special ordered it all the time and people in line would hear him order it and ask for it too...
